== Function ==
[https://www.uniprot.org/uniprot/PURE_MYCTU PURE_MYCTU] Catalyzes the conversion of N5-carboxyaminoimidazole ribonucleotide (N5-CAIR) to 4-carboxy-5-aminoimidazole ribonucleotide (CAIR) (By similarity).
